Funeral services for Charles R Carney, 76, Massena at Sacred Heart Church in Massena. Arrangements with Phillips Memorial Home in Massena. Mr. Carney drowned Jul. 20, 1983 while fishing behind his home.
Surviving are his wife Rose; three sons, Paulo of Massena, John of East Dorset, VT, and Thomas of Johnson, VT; one brother Downer of Massena; four sisters, Mrs. Mable Dowe, Mrs. Mae Bloff both of Massena, Mrs. Evelyn Pringle of Vallisjou, CA and Mrs. Mildred Clark of Black River; 6 grandchildren. Mr. Carney was born in Massena on May 25, 1907, son of Orvill and Mary Prashaw Carney. He attended Massena schools and worked at the IGA in Massena Springs and worked at Alcoa from 1942-1971. He married Rose Cappiello on May 4, 1936 at Sacred Heart Church in Massena with Rev. Luker officiating.
